Design and build:
JBL Boombox 2 and 3 are available in different color options.
Similarities:
JBL Boombox 2 and 3 have excellent build quality. They have rugged design and sturdy build. Their cylindrical body is protected by tight fabric grille. Similar to Boombox 3, the Boombox 2 has built-in handle that makes it easier to carry from one place to another.
Differences:
Comparing JBL Boombox 2 vs Boombox 3, the Boombox 3 is more suitable for outdoor use. It has an IP67 rating whereas the Boombox 2 has IPX7 rating. With Boombox 2, you will not have protection against dust. While the speakers are similar sized, the Boombox 3 is a bit heavier than the Boombox 2.
Performance:
Comparing JBL Boombox 2 vs Boombox 3, the Boombox 3 plays better sound.
Similarities:
JBL Boombox 2 and Boombox 3 can play stereo sound. The speakers have good soundstage with decent focus. They can get quite loud but the Boombox 2 will give better sound when played at moderate volumes. If you want louder sound without any noticeable distortion then the Boombox 3 will be better.
Differences:
JBL Boombox 2 has dual 0.75" tweeters and dual 4" woofers along with 4" passive radiators. The speaker can deliver detailed highs and deep lows. While both speakers can deliver balanced sound, the Boombox 3 is much better at it. The Boombox 3 has two 0.75" tweeters, two 2.75" midrange drivers, and 3.1875” woofers.
It also has 2 5” passive radiators and is driven by more amount of power. Vocals and instrumental sounds are powerful and clean. It has rich highs, decent mids and impactful bass. This bass response makes movies and music quite enjoyable. Overall, both speakers can deliver intense sound but the Boombox 3 is slightly better.

Features:
Let us have a look at the JBL Boombox 2 and 3 speaker features.
Connectivity:
They have an aux port and also supports wireless Bluetooth. Like other JBL Bluetooth speakers, they can connect up to two devices at once. The Bluetooth connection remain stable and they offer low latency.
Multi-speaker pairing:
The speakers support PartyBoost feature and can connect up to 100 JBL speakers that are compatible with PartyBoost. You can also connect JBL Boombox 2 to the Boombox 3.

Control options:
Control options are similar in both speakers. Physical buttons are for basic controls like volume up/down, play/pause, forward, Bluetooth and PartyBoost options. You can also use the JBL Portable mobile app.
Portability:
JBL Boombox 2 and 3 are almost similar size and weight. With the handle, they are easy to move as you are on the go. That said, they are not quite suitable if you want to carry it for a long time like during hiking or climbing.
Use case:
The Boombox 2 and 3 are suitable for both indoor and outdoor use. They are great for pool or beach parties. However, if you want to take one in a dust prone area like construction site, the Boombox 3 with dust protection will be a better choice.
